Implementing Zero Suicide in Health Systems

The purpose of this program is to provide resources to healthcare systems for implementing the Zero Suicide framework for adults who are at risk of suicide.

Details

  • Agency: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Adminis
  • Department: Department of Health and Human Services
  • Opportunity #: SM-26-008
  • Total Funding: $16,110,545
  • Expected Awards: 31
  • Instrument: cooperative_agreement

Eligibility

Eligibility is statutorily limited to community-based primary care or behavioral health care settings, emergency departments, State mental health agencies, public health agencies, United States territories, and Indian Tribes/tribal organizations.
